Vallarai salad
vallarai leaves
pineapple
onions
green chillies
vinegar or lime juice
sugar
salt
Method :
cut every thing fine, add enough sugar,salt and lime juice.
Its very tasty eaten as a salad.
You can omit pineapple and add tomatoes if you like.
Vallarai Masiyal
Cook little toor dal, with tumeric and green chillie.
Add the chopped vallarai leaves.
Make a seasoning with little cumin, mustard seeds
and urad dal. Add salt and remove.
Vallarai chappati.
Cut the leaves fine and add to the flour
before you knead. Roll into chapattis
and cook the same way.
Vallarai Drink.
Boil the leaves with rock sugar.
Chill and drink.

[tscii]This is also a disappearing dish from Chettinad
PAAL PANIYARAM
Ingredients:
½ cup raw rice
½ cup urad dal
1 litre milk from 1 coconut
Sugar enough to sweeten the milk
Few cardamoms crushed
Oil to fry
A pinch of salt
Method:
Soak raw rice and urad dal for 2 hours.
Add little salt and grind the batter to idli consistency.
Heat the milk, sugar and cardamom. Mix it well.
Do not let it boil, remove it from fire.
Heat oil, add the batter little by little.
It should form round balls.
Deep fry till golden brown.
Remove the paniyaram and drop it in a pot of cold water.
Strain it and add to the warm milk.
Let it soak well and serve it in a bowl.
Note: you have to grind the batter very fine.
Otherwise the paniyaram might burst while frying.

Instant panniyaram
Quick receipe for kara panniyaram
---------------------------------
Left over appam batter, if u have idli/ dosa batter . then mix both the batters.
In a kadai, give tadka like as usual. oil, kadukku, urad dhal, kadalai paruppu. then u can add finely chopped onions, green chilles and red chillies according to our wish. Then add curry leaves. U can also add grated carrots, cabbage. saute for 2 to 3 minutes, little corainder leaves (optional).
transfer this in the batter mixture. If u want u remove the chillies now, so that it will not come in ur mouth.
Mix nicely. Here we are using the leftover batters, sometimes it will be too much sour, for that u can add 1/4 tsp of sugar so that the sour taste will not come.
Now in the kuzhi paniyara pan, u can make like kuzhi paniyaram. Kids will like this. This will be a good breakfast for the kids.
